"Safe Harbor" is a short-lived TV series from 1999. A widower and his children live in a motel. Gregory Harrison played the lead role in a cast that also included Rue McClanahan, Christopher Khayman Lee, Chyler Leigh, Jamie Martin, Jeremy Lelliott (later in the cast of "Seventh Heaven"), Jamie Williams, Orlando Brown.

This is from the TVGuide site:


A single father tries to raise his three sons while working as a sheriff in a Florida community. Assisting him at home (a former motel) is his eccentric mother, a former magician's assistant.
